The 1927 Cork Intermediate Hurling Championship was the 18th staging of the Cork Intermediate Hurling Championship since its establishment by the Cork County Board. [1]

Contents

The final was played on 15 January 1927 at Riverstown Sportsfield, between Fr Mathew Hall and Cobh, in what was their first ever meeting in the final. [2] Fr Mathew Hall won the match by 3–02 to 1–01, however, a subsequent objection by Cobh regarding an illeagl player was upheld and they were declared the champions. [3] Buttevant were later declared runners-up as they had also objected to Fr Mathew Hall on the same grounds following their semi-final defeat. [4] [5]
